Dual and Multiple Associations of Persons Associated With Swap Dealers, Major Swap Participants and Other Commission Registrants; Proposed Rule (CFTC)

See: 77 FR 35892

The CFTC is proposing regulations that would provide for dual and multiple associations of persons associated with SDs, MSPs and other Commission registrants (i.e., FCMs, retail foreign exchange dealers (RFEDs). The proposal would make clear that each swap dealer (SD), major swap participant (MSP), and other CFTC registrant with whom an associated person (AP) is associated registrant with whom an associated person (AP) is associated is required to supervise the AP and is jointly and severally responsible for the activities of the AP with respect to customers common to it and any other SD, MSP or other CFTC registrant (proposal).

Comments Due: August 14, 2012

Cross References: CFTC Rules 3.12 and 23.22.
